Santo Antonio Do Ica (IPG) to Dorval (YUL)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Ipiranga Airport (IPG) in Santo Antonio Do Ica, Brazil to Montréal / Pierre Elliott Trudeau International Airport (YUL) in Dorval, Canada is 5,398 kilometers (3,354 miles / 2,915 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 7h, flying north at a heading of 356°.

This is a long-haul route typically operated by wide-body aircraft such as the Boeing 777 or Airbus A350. Full meal service, in-flight entertainment, and comfort amenities are standard.

This is an international route connecting Brazil with Canada. It is an intercontinental flight between South America and North America.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 09:58 in Santo Antonio Do Ica, it's 08:58 in Dorval.

The return flight from Dorval (YUL) to Santo Antonio Do Ica (IPG) follows a heading of 175° (south).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
